Economy & Jobs
The median household income in Catlett is $123,403, which is significantly higher than the national average — 64% above $75,149. This places Catlett among higher-income communities.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.0%. Only 0.0%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 50 minutes, longer than the typical American commute of 28 minutes.
Cost of Living & Housing
The median home value in Catlett is $336,100, 19% above the national median. At just 2.7x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.
Education
13.7%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 89.2%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.6/10.
Climate & Weather
Catlett exper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 55°F. Winters average 34°F in January while summers reach 75°F in July.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 35.
Catlett has a population of 139 with a density of 43 people per square mile. The median age is 62.0 years, 59%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(74.1%), with 25.9% Black.
